In Scottsdale’s commercial buildings, mold most often starts where water lingers: flat roofs during monsoon season, condensate lines at hard‑working HVAC systems, irrigation overspray against exterior walls, and plumbing runs serving restrooms and kitchens. Walk‑in coolers and mechanical rooms can also produce recurring condensation that wets nearby drywall or framing.
Once moisture is present, mold colonizes porous building materials common in offices and retail—ceiling tiles, drywall, MDF millwork, carpet backings, and paper‑faced insulation. Left alone, it stains finishes, weakens gypsum cores, delaminates laminates, and can spread into wall cavities and above drop ceilings, impacting multiple suites in a Scottsdale plaza or mid‑rise.
What sets the size of a Scottsdale job is the moisture source and how long materials stayed wet, not just the square footage you can see. Porous versus non‑porous surfaces, height of ceilings, whether the HVAC system is affected, and how much controlled demolition is needed all change the amount of containment, filtration, and cleaning required.
Commercial properties in Scottsdale also bring documentation needs: photos, moisture maps, and a clear scope for property managers, tenants, and insurers. Food service and health‑sensitive spaces may require tighter controls around prep areas and return‑to‑service plans that fit the building’s operations without spreading growth to clean zones.

In Scottsdale workplaces, warning signs include musty odors, stained or sagging ceiling tiles after monsoon rains, recurring spots on drywall or baseboards, and increased coughing or congestion among staff near certain rooms.
Here is the typical sequence for commercial mold remediation in Scottsdale, AZ, from assessment through final documentation and clearance.
Set up containment with plastic sheeting and negative air to prevent spread.
Wear protective gear and place HEPA air scrubbers to capture spores.
Remove contaminated drywall, insulation, carpet, and debris in sealed bags.
HEPA vacuum and wipe all surfaces with antimicrobial cleaning solutions.
Dry the structure with dehumidifiers and fix minor moisture sources.
Final HEPA cleanup and a walkthrough to confirm the area is clean and dry.

(866) 785-1333In Scottsdale, AZ, commercial mold remediation typically ranges from $2,000 to $20,000, with many mid‑size projects around $6,000. Scope, materials, access, and any third‑party testing affect the total. We prepare a written estimate for Scottsdale, AZ properties before work starts.
In Scottsdale, AZ, most commercial jobs run 1 to 5 days, depending on area size and how many materials need removal. Drying can be quicker here once the source is fixed and airflow is managed. Large, multi‑suite buildings in Scottsdale, AZ may take longer due to staging and clearances.
Commercial mold work in Scottsdale, AZ generally includes containment, removal of damaged porous materials, HEPA cleaning of surfaces, and drying to normal levels. It also includes source‑of‑moisture verification and project documentation for your records in Scottsdale, AZ.
In Scottsdale, AZ, coverage depends on your policy and cause; sudden events like a burst line are often covered, while long‑term leaks or maintenance issues may not be. Insurers in Scottsdale, AZ typically ask for photos, moisture readings, and an itemized scope.

In Scottsdale, AZ, prevention centers on fixing the moisture source, maintaining HVAC to control condensation, and keeping roof drains clear before monsoon season. Routine checks of restrooms, break rooms, and flat roofs in Scottsdale, AZ help stop small leaks from becoming mold growth.
